They made their home in Salem Twp., Delaware County, Indiana in 1860, where Zur was a Farmer, and Sarah was taking care of the home and children, Hamilton-12, Job-5, Mary J-3,and Mahala C-9 months old.[4]
He was a Civil War Veteran, serving as a Private, in Company B, 69th Indiana Infantry.[5]
He and Sarah, were retired from farming in 1900, were living in Washington Twp., Delaware County, Indiana.[3]
He died on January 21, 1917, at the age of 91, in Delaware County, Indiana,[6] and was buried in the Prairie Grove Cemetery.[1]
